A new 76 page hardback or 80 page paperback book telling the full, lost story behind one of Elland Road's most dramatic days: the death of centre-forward David 'Soldier' Wilson, while playing for Leeds City in 1906.

Now in stock

On 27th October, 1906, a young Leeds City footballer died during a match against Burnley. That much was known. But over the years what else was known about him has become mixed up and forgotten. Here is the story of the death of David 'Soldier' Wilson, and the story of his life.

⭑ a tragic but sweet upbringing in Leith

⭑ ruling Edinburgh with Yardheads school

⭑ pioneering knee surgery

⭑ suspension by Dundee for 'misbehaviour'

⭑ the first player ever sent off for Hull

⭑ a death that set newspaper columnists aflame

⭑ a daughter he never knew
